§ 19-5-10 — Fiduciary Not Liable for Acts in Good Faith
Any fiduciary who in good faith acts or fails to act shall not be liable to any person for taking or failing to take any action authorized or required by this chapter.

Legislative History
(Acts 1988, No. 88-340, p. 516, §10.)
